I was born in Germiston in the old Transvaal and our family spent our annual holidays in Durban or thereabouts. Our trips down were often sidetracked by my dad wishing to visit some of the many battlefields on our route as he had a keen interest in the ABW.
An interest he passed on to me despite me now living in Canada.
It encouraged my son and I one of our many visits to SA to produce a video on the Strathcona's Horse Regiments role in the ABW as we discovered many Canadians had very little knowledge of this regiment's role in the war.
We have managed to get our video onto Youtube under the general heading of Strathcona's Horse. It runs for close to 40 minutes and is, we hope, a fair portrayal of Canada's involvement in the war.
